EDITORS COMMENTS
This print captures "The Temptation of Saint Anthony (Left wing of a triptych)" with remarkable detail and precision. Housed in the esteemed Collection of Museu Nacional de Arte Antiga in Lisbon, this painting is a testament to the rich artistic heritage of the Netherlands. In this scene, we witness Saint Anthony, an ascetic Christian monk known for his unwavering faith and devotion, facing a series of temptations within a dark cave. Painted by an anonymous artist from the early Netherlandish art movement, every brushstroke brings to life the tribulations endured by this revered saint. As Saint Anthony resists these trials, his steadfast belief shines through amidst ghostly apparitions and eerie visions that surround him. The oil on wood technique employed here adds depth and texture to each element portrayed. "The Temptation of Saint Anthony" serves as both a spiritual narrative and an exploration into human vulnerability. It reminds us that even those who are deeply devoted can be tested by their own desires and external influences. With its profound symbolism and exquisite craftsmanship, this masterpiece continues to inspire viewers today. As we gaze upon it, we are transported back in time to witness the inner struggles faced by one man seeking enlightenment in solitude – Saint Anthony the Hermit.
